Natalya Nikolayevna Pertsova (until 1971 - Moiseyeva ; March 19, 1945 - October 25, 2015 , Moscow ) - Soviet and Russian linguist , literary critic , specialist in the work of Velimir Khlebnikov . Doctor of Philology, Associate Professor .

Biography
She graduated from the Maurice Thorez Moscow State Institute of Foreign Languages with a degree in Structural, Applied and Mathematical Linguistics [1] .
Since 1976, she worked at MV Lomonosov Moscow State University [1] .
In 1977, at the Council at MV Lomonosov Moscow State University, she defended her thesis for the degree of candidate of philological sciences on the topic "On the problem of modeling text understanding" [2] .
Leading researcher at the Laboratory of Automated Lexicographic Systems, Scientific Research Computing Center , MV Lomonosov Moscow State University (since 1979) [2] .
In 2000, in a council at the VV Vinogradov Institute of Russian Language of the Russian Academy of Sciences, she defended her thesis for the degree of Doctor of Philology on the topic “Word-making and related problems of Velimir Khlebnikov's idiostyle” [2] .
Translated several books and articles on linguistics from the English language for the Progress Publishing House (mainly in the series New in Foreign Linguistics ). In the 1970s, she wrote several hundred abstracts and reviews of works on automatic word processing and artificial intelligence for abstract journals "Informatics" and "Express Information" and the journal "Scientific and Technical Information" [1] .
In the 1970s and 1980s, she was the supervisor of a number of business contracts (with the Computing Center of the Siberian Branch of the Academy of Sciences of the USSR, the VNTICenter and other organizations) devoted to the development of artificial intelligence systems and automatic word processing [1] .
Fulbright Researcher [1] .
Member of the program committee of the X International Khlebnikov readings “The work of V. Khlebnikov and Russian literature of the 20th century: poetics, textology, traditions” (Astrakhan, September 3-5, 2008) [2] .
She died on October 25, 2015 [3] .
Family
- Father - Nikolai Dmitrievich Moiseev (1902-1955), Soviet astronomer, mechanic, historian of science.
- Her husband is Nikolai Viktorovich Pertsov (born 1944), a linguist and literary critic.
Scientific activity
- His research interests included computer semantics and word formation of the modern Russian language [4] and the work of Velimir Khlebnikov .
- Under the leadership of Natalya Pertsova, the following were developed:
- computer model of word formation and word creation - an automated lexicographic system RUSLO,
- specialized linguistic database management system "Thesaurus",
- an experimental computer system was created for automatic analysis and synthesis of derivatives and complex words of the Russian language [4] .
- From the 1990s until her death in 2015, she studied the language of Russian avant-garde literature, in particular:
- word-making,
- specialized in the creation of Velimir Khlebnikov;
- led a group of linguists [1] .

Teaching and educational activities
- In 1982-1988, she read special courses on the introduction to linguistics, on semantic models, aspects of artificial intelligence, etc. [4] at the Faculty of Computational Mathematics and Cybernetics of Moscow State University named after MV Lomonosov .
- In 1992-1994, she taught at the Russian State University for the Humanities special courses in the automatic processing of natural language [4] .
- Since 1999, as an assistant professor (concurrently) at Moscow State Linguistic University, she taught special courses on lexical semantics, translation theory, and the main course “Introduction to Linguistics” [4] .
- She lectured at universities in the USA , Germany , the Netherlands , France and Austria [1] .
- In 1988, she published a textbook, Formalization of the Interpretation of a Word.
